A thoughtful, research-based discussion of Black homeschool experiences as models for educational improvement in K–12 public education In Creating Educational Justice, Cheryl Fields-Smith upholds the decisions of Black parents to homeschool their children as acts of empowerment, resistance, and educational justice. The work spotlights the various motivations of Black families to home educate, bringing attention to key issues facing K–12 public schooling in the United States. Fields-Smith shares the voices and perspectives of sixty Black home educators from a range of demographic backgrounds.Many of these families moved to homeschooling after students began their formal education in public schools, citing both problems endemic to US public schools (curriculum limitations, teacher shortages, and inadequate resources) and those faced particularly by Black students (marginalization of Black parents’ engagement, deficit narratives surrounding Black student ability, discriminatory disciplinary practices, and overrepresentation in special education) as reasons for their switch. Their stories demonstrate the many ways in which Black home education curates learning opportunities that promote positive identity development and racial healing, as well as academic success, in ways that traditional schools often cannot. Fields-Smith argues that public educators can learn much from Black homeschool parents’ decision-making, folk pedagogy, and educational practice.This work offers a wealth of constructive feedback for teachers, school administrators, and policymakers that can inform teacher education practices, school administration approaches, and education reform measures and help build stronger school-family-community partnerships.
